The joys of watching La Liga 2. Almeria played Alcorcon last night. Kick off was 10pm, and it usually takes 1.5 hours to get home after a match finishes. Too hot for an earlier kick off really, 27* at 10pm.

What a frustrating team Almeria are to watch. Top ‘v’ bottom, and a win for Almeria guarantees promotion. It just wouldn’t go in, till the 93min. Almeria equalised in injury time but drop to second in the league. 1 match left with automatic promotion still in their own hands - 2nd will do, but 3rd place is only 2pts behind.

Will Almeria blow it, as they did last season, or dare I dream… at least the season ticket isn’t expensive @ €120.
